This report provides an extensive cost evaluation of DMAPA (Dimethylaminopropylamine) production from the chemical reaction between acrylonitrile and dimethyl amine. Initially, the chemical reaction between acrylonitrile and dimethyl amine leads to the production of 3-dimethylaminopropionitrile. The resultant product is then hydrogenated to produce dimethylaminopropylamine along with other byproducts. Finally, the following compound is then subjected to multiple distillations that yield pure dimethylaminopropylamine as the final product.
